Muslim, Sikh, and Hindu Wedding Photographers
When selecting a photographer for your wedding, it’s crucial to choose someone experienced with your specific cultural and religious traditions. Photographers for Muslim weddings are aware of the importance of the Nikah ceremony, Pakistani Wedding Photography the Walima, and other Islamic customs. Sikh ceremony photographers focus on the holy ceremonies in the Gurdwara and the cheerful events afterward. Hindu wedding photographers preserve the detailed Mandap setting, the Saat Phere, and the numerous traditions that make a traditional Hindu ceremony so special.
